    ODUMODUBLVCK, Stormzy and Zlatan unite for 'PAY ME'

    AdminBy AdminAugust 22, 2025No Comments1 Min Read
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email Copy Link

    The three dynamic forces have joined forces for what promises to be one of the year’s most electrifying collaborations.

    Nigerian hip-hop sensation ODUMODUBLVCK, UK grime heavyweight Stormzy, and street-pop king Zlatan have officially released their highly anticipated single, PAY ME.

    The track represents a seamless fusion of three distinct worlds. ODUMODUBLVCK brings his hard-hitting and exuberant Nigerian rap style, while Stormzy contributes his renowned UK grime energy, and Zlatan adds his usual street-pop flow. Together, they’ve created a sonic experience that sees beyond geographical boundaries.

    PAY ME is a fusion of hip-hop and highlife music. The track honours Ghanaian hip-hop classic, Ahomka Womu; it sees all three acts feeling themselves at the highest level. It explores themes of ambition and, of course, the relentless pursuit of success. The collaboration exhibits how contemporary African music continues to influence international sounds.

    ODUMODUBLVCK has emerged as one of Nigeria’s most renowned rappers, known for his distinctive flow and authentic street narratives that resonate with listeners across Africa and beyond.

    This collaboration arrives at a pivotal moment in the music industry, as African artists continue to gain unprecedented international recognition. PAY ME exemplifies the growing trend of cross-continental partnerships that are reshaping the modern music landscape.
